[anjuta] manual: Build mallard manual by default and also use it in the help menu
- From: Johannes Schmid <jhs src gnome org>
- To: commits-list gnome org
- Cc:
- Subject: [anjuta] manual: Build mallard manual by default and also use it in the help menu
- Date: Mon, 4 Jul 2011 20:23:25 +0000 (UTC)
commit cedb939b4876f8c58edccd781b5a881392a11599
Author: Johannes Schmid <jhs gnome org>
Date: Mon Jul 4 21:51:52 2011 +0200
manual: Build mallard manual by default and also use it in the help menu
manuals/anjuta-manual/C/anjuta-manual.xml | 115 ---
manuals/anjuta-manual/C/authors.xml | 24 -
manuals/anjuta-manual/C/build.xml | 272 ------
manuals/anjuta-manual/C/compileopts.xml | 547 -----------
manuals/anjuta-manual/C/debugger.xml | 997 --------------------
manuals/anjuta-manual/C/figures/add_edit_macro.png | Bin 25973 -> 0 bytes
.../anjuta-manual/C/figures/anjuta-in-action.png | Bin 176370 -> 0 bytes
manuals/anjuta-manual/C/figures/anjuta_logo.png | Bin 3634 -> 0 bytes
manuals/anjuta-manual/C/figures/attach.png | Bin 48320 -> 0 bytes
manuals/anjuta-manual/C/figures/brk_add.png | Bin 15940 -> 0 bytes
manuals/anjuta-manual/C/figures/brk_dlg.png | Bin 17607 -> 0 bytes
manuals/anjuta-manual/C/figures/ccview_class.png | Bin 14512 -> 0 bytes
manuals/anjuta-manual/C/figures/configure_dlg.png | Bin 12739 -> 0 bytes
manuals/anjuta-manual/C/figures/display_macro.png | Bin 35228 -> 0 bytes
manuals/anjuta-manual/C/figures/editor_guides.png | Bin 22987 -> 0 bytes
manuals/anjuta-manual/C/figures/editor_margins.png | Bin 7193 -> 0 bytes
manuals/anjuta-manual/C/figures/editor_markers.png | Bin 7098 -> 0 bytes
manuals/anjuta-manual/C/figures/file_menu.png | Bin 16491 -> 0 bytes
manuals/anjuta-manual/C/figures/insert_text.png | Bin 71073 -> 0 bytes
manuals/anjuta-manual/C/figures/keyword_macro.png | Bin 18108 -> 0 bytes
.../anjuta-manual/C/figures/local_variables.png | Bin 34710 -> 0 bytes
manuals/anjuta-manual/C/figures/menu_detached.png | Bin 24366 -> 0 bytes
manuals/anjuta-manual/C/figures/menubar.png | Bin 4507 -> 0 bytes
manuals/anjuta-manual/C/figures/message_win.png | Bin 15585 -> 0 bytes
.../anjuta-manual/C/figures/new_file_wizard.png | Bin 32500 -> 0 bytes
manuals/anjuta-manual/C/figures/open_file.png | Bin 81211 -> 0 bytes
.../anjuta-manual/C/figures/open_file_multiple.png | Bin 81713 -> 0 bytes
manuals/anjuta-manual/C/figures/prefs_print.png | Bin 48200 -> 0 bytes
manuals/anjuta-manual/C/figures/print_dlg.png | Bin 33562 -> 0 bytes
manuals/anjuta-manual/C/figures/print_preview.png | Bin 76539 -> 0 bytes
manuals/anjuta-manual/C/figures/project-window.png | Bin 28321 -> 0 bytes
manuals/anjuta-manual/C/figures/project_group.png | Bin 34424 -> 0 bytes
manuals/anjuta-manual/C/figures/project_info.png | Bin 54795 -> 0 bytes
manuals/anjuta-manual/C/figures/project_target.png | Bin 19659 -> 0 bytes
.../C/figures/project_target_details.png | Bin 27125 -> 0 bytes
manuals/anjuta-manual/C/figures/registers.png | Bin 13317 -> 0 bytes
manuals/anjuta-manual/C/figures/save_as_file.png | Bin 82427 -> 0 bytes
manuals/anjuta-manual/C/figures/search_expr.png | Bin 32494 -> 0 bytes
.../anjuta-manual/C/figures/search_expr_basic.png | Bin 33372 -> 0 bytes
.../C/figures/search_file_pattern.png | Bin 49135 -> 0 bytes
manuals/anjuta-manual/C/figures/search_replace.png | Bin 32256 -> 0 bytes
manuals/anjuta-manual/C/figures/search_setting.png | Bin 26155 -> 0 bytes
manuals/anjuta-manual/C/figures/search_target.png | Bin 31930 -> 0 bytes
.../C/figures/search_target_action.png | Bin 31914 -> 0 bytes
.../anjuta-manual/C/figures/search_target_in.png | Bin 35677 -> 0 bytes
manuals/anjuta-manual/C/figures/sharedlibs.png | Bin 81634 -> 0 bytes
manuals/anjuta-manual/C/figures/signals.png | Bin 45111 -> 0 bytes
manuals/anjuta-manual/C/figures/stack.png | Bin 16965 -> 0 bytes
manuals/anjuta-manual/C/figures/symbol_browser.png | Bin 16830 -> 0 bytes
manuals/anjuta-manual/C/figures/tool-editor.png | Bin 53572 -> 0 bytes
manuals/anjuta-manual/C/fileoperations.xml | 631 -------------
manuals/anjuta-manual/C/glade.xml | 199 ----
manuals/anjuta-manual/C/interface.xml | 178 ----
manuals/anjuta-manual/C/introduction.xml | 54 --
manuals/anjuta-manual/C/legal.xml | 75 --
manuals/anjuta-manual/C/license.xml | 30 -
manuals/anjuta-manual/C/preferences.xml | 39 -
manuals/anjuta-manual/C/projects.xml | 781 ---------------
manuals/anjuta-manual/C/template.xml | 7 -
manuals/anjuta-manual/C/tools.xml | 47 -
manuals/anjuta-manual/Makefile.am | 79 +-
src/action-callbacks.c | 8 +-
62 files changed, 37 insertions(+), 4046 deletions(-)
---
diff --git a/manuals/anjuta-manual/Makefile.am b/manuals/anjuta-manual/Makefile.am
index 9fbd77b..be75185 100644
--- a/manuals/anjuta-manual/Makefile.am
+++ b/manuals/anjuta-manual/Makefile.am
@@ -1,54 +1,35 @@
include $(top_srcdir)/gnome-doc-utils.make
+
dist-hook: doc-dist-hook
-DOC_MODULE = anjuta-manual
-DOC_ENTITIES = legal.xml debugger.xml introduction.xml projects.xml \
- authors.xml legal.xml template.xml \
- fileoperations.xml license.xml tools.xml \
- interface.xml preferences.xml build.xml \
- glade.xml
-DOC_AM_CPPFLAGS =
-DOC_FIGURES = figures/add_edit_macro.png \
- figures/anjuta-in-action.png \
- figures/attach.png\
- figures/brk_add.png\
- figures/brk_dlg.png\
- figures/configure_dlg.png\
- figures/display_macro.png\
- figures/editor_guides.png\
- figures/editor_margins.png\
- figures/editor_markers.png\
- figures/file_menu.png\
- figures/insert_text.png\
- figures/keyword_macro.png\
- figures/local_variables.png\
- figures/menubar.png\
- figures/message_win.png\
- figures/new_file_wizard.png\
- figures/open_file.png\
- figures/open_file_multiple.png\
- figures/prefs_print.png\
- figures/print_dlg.png\
- figures/print_preview.png\
- figures/project_info.png\
- figures/project_group.png\
- figures/project_target.png\
- figures/project_target_details.png\
- figures/project-window.png\
- figures/registers.png\
- figures/save_as_file.png\
- figures/search_expr.png\
- figures/search_expr_basic.png\
- figures/search_file_pattern.png\
- figures/search_replace.png\
- figures/search_setting.png\
- figures/search_target.png\
- figures/search_target_action.png\
- figures/search_target_in.png\
- figures/sharedlibs.png\
- figures/signals.png\
- figures/stack.png\
- figures/symbol_browser.png\
- figures/tool-editor.png
+
+DOC_ID = anjuta-manual
+DOC_PAGES = anjuta-code-assist.page \
+ anjuta-code-help.page \
+ anjuta-code-indentation.page \
+ anjuta-code-symbols.page \
+ anjuta-debug-breakpoints.page \
+ anjuta-debug-crash.page \
+ anjuta-debug-watches.page \
+ anjuta-glade-signals.page \
+ anjuta-glade-start.page \
+ anjuta-run.page \
+ autotools-build-build.page \
+ autotools-build-clean.page \
+ autotools-build-compile.page \
+ autotools-build-configure-dialog.page \
+ autotools-build-install.page \
+ autotools-build-plugin.page \
+ autotools-build-preferences-dialog.page \
+ directory-project-backend.page \
+ project-manager-file.page \
+ project-manager-library.page \
+ project-manager-module.page \
+ project-manager.page \
+ project-wizard-create.page \
+ project-wizard-template.page \
+ widget-index.page
+
+DOC_FIGURES =
DOC_LINGUAS = cs da de el es eu fr ja oc sl sv th uk zh_CN
-include $(top_srcdir)/git.mk
diff --git a/src/action-callbacks.c b/src/action-callbacks.c
index 2b5207f..71f1b86 100644
--- a/src/action-callbacks.c
+++ b/src/action-callbacks.c
@@ -129,7 +129,13 @@ help_activate (GtkWidget *parent, const gchar *doc_id, const gchar *item)
void
on_help_manual_activate (GtkAction *action, gpointer data)
{
- help_activate (data, "anjuta-manual", "anjuta-manual.xml");
+ GError* error = NULL;
+ if (!g_spawn_command_line_async ("yelp ghelp:anjuta-manual", &error) &&
+ error)
+ {
+ g_warning ("Could open FAQ: %s", error->message);
+ g_error_free (error);
+ }
}
void
[
Date Prev][
Date Next] [
Thread Prev][
Thread Next]
[
Thread Index]
[
Date Index]
[
Author Index]